TransAlta fully retires all the units of its Wabamun power plant
TransAlta Corporation (TSX:TA); (NYSE:TAC) reported that after 54 years reliably providing power for Albertans, it has fully retired all the units of its Wabamun power plant.

The Wabamun Plant is one of three coal-fired generating stations built in the Wabamun Lake area, 70 kilometres west of Edmonton, Alberta. On average over the service life of the Wabamun Plant it annually produced 3.7 million megawatt-hours (MWh) of energy – enough each year to supply about 500,000 Alberta households.
